In September, the 14th concert season of Jazz Estonia will begin!

At the opening concert of the season, which takes at the NO99 Jazz Club on 8 September, The Swingin’ Sisters & Band takes the stage and Tallinn Swing Dance Society dancers set the mood in front of it – a great swing party is expected! The new season will begin in all other Jazz Clubs as well.

In September, the Jazz Estonia is organising five concerts in Tallinn:

  • On 15 September, the concert to celebrate the centenary of Thelonious Monk – one of the grandees of jazz history, a pianist and a composer – will take place at the NO99 Jazz Club. As a tribute, music is played by the best Estonian and Finnish jazz musicians.
  • On 22 September, Kolm Kõla performs at the NO99 Jazz Club. They use a rare combination of the Estonian zither, a double-bass and a vocal, also different music styles.
  • On 23 September, Kadi Vija & Lucas Dann are at the Philly Joe’s Jazz Club presenting their debut album Ugly Beauty which is a tribute to the jazz grandee Thelonious Monk.
  • On 29 September, Maria Faust & Dag Magnus Narvesen are performing at the NO99 Jazz Club – both performers are first known by their large ensembles but this time the audience will receive simplicity, spontaneity, and the magic of acoustic sounds.

There are eight concerts organised outside Tallinn in September:

  • The concert celebrating the centenary of Thelonius Monk – one of the grandees of jazz history, a pianist and a composer – will take place on 16 September at the Jazz Club of the University Café in Tartu.
  • Linda Kanter Quartet are going on a mini tour presenting their debut album Mustab and will perform at Jazz Club WALK on 21 September, at Võru Jazz Club on 22 September, at Rakvere Jazzukohvik on 23 September, and at Jazz Time Club on 30 September.
  • Kadi Vija & Lucas Dann with their debut album Ugly Beauty will perform at Endla Jazz Club on 22 September, making it a tribute to Thelonious Monk, the jazz grandee.
  • Maria Faust & Dag Magnus Narvesen, this time experimenting in a small duo, will perform at Viljandi Jazz Club on 26 September and at the Jazz Club of the University Café in Tartu on 30 September.
